Overview

Arthur Werner will provide financial professionals with the information their teams will need to successfully plan and execute mergers and acquisitions.

Highlights

Taxable asset acquisitions vs. non-taxable stock/equity acquisitions. What happens in an asset acquisition. What happens in a stock or equity acquisition. 338 and 336 elections. Basics of 382. Basics of 280G. Earnouts and contingent payments. Assumed liabilities. Acquired reserves. Acquired deferred revenue. Treatment of transaction costs. Basics of mixed entity transactions. Partnership acquisitions of various entity types. Very basic overview of tax-free re-organizations. High level overview of entity formations. High level overview of entity liquidations or termination.

Prerequisites

At least three years’ experience in mergers and acquisitions.

Designed For

Designed for CPAs with three to five years of experience with mergers and acquisitions.

Objectives

Differentiate issues related to asset acquisitions and stock acquisitions. Explain various elections (such as IRC Sections 336 and 338). Describe mixed entity transactions.

Art Werner is currently a shareholder in and is the President of the lecture firm Werner - Rocca Seminars, Ltd. Mr. Werner’s areas of expertise include business, tax, financial, and estate planning for high net worth individuals. In addition, Mr. Werner is an adjunct professor of taxation in the Master of Science in Taxation program at the Philadelphia University located in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. Mr. Werner received his B.S. in Accounting and his M.S. in Taxation from Widener University. He holds a J.D. in Law from the Delaware Law School. Mr. Werner lectures extensively in the areas of Estate Planning, Financial Planning, and Estate and Gift Taxation to Certified Public Accountants, Enrolled Agents, Insurance Agents, and Financial Planners, and has presented well in excess of 2,000 eight-hour seminars over the past 20 years. Over the past 20 years, Mr. Werner was rated as having the highest speaker knowledge in his home state of Pennsylvania by the Pennsylvania Institute of Certified Public Accountants, was awarded the AICPA Outstanding Discussion Leader Award in the State of Nevada, the Florida Institute of CPAs Outstanding Discussion Leader Award, and the South Carolina Association of CPAs Outstanding Discussion Leader Award.
